Javascript 如何重定向到thankyou.html页面(PHP)

Javascript 如何重定向到thankyou.html页面(PHP),javascript,php,html,phpmyadmin,Javascript,Php,Html,Phpmyadmin,邮件发送后,我试图重定向到thankyou.html,但我没有这样做 我使用了header选项,但它对我不起作用。 可能是我做错了什么。 当有人提交此查询时,页面应该转到thankyou.html,我已经创建了此页面 这是我的php脚本 <?php include("connect.php"); if(isset($_POST['submit'])){ $name = $_POST['name']; $email = $_POST['email']; $phone = $_POS

邮件发送后,我试图重定向到thankyou.html,但我没有这样做

我使用了header选项,但它对我不起作用。 可能是我做错了什么。 当有人提交此查询时,页面应该转到thankyou.html,我已经创建了此页面

这是我的php脚本

<?php
include("connect.php");

if(isset($_POST['submit'])){

 $name = $_POST['name'];
 $email = $_POST['email'];
 $phone = $_POST['phone'];
 $treatment = $_POST['treatment'];
 $gender = $_POST['gender'];
 $date = date('y/m/d');
 $message = $_POST['message'];

 $to = 'enquiry@kbc.com' ;
 $subject = 'Inquiry' ;


 $query = "insert into inquiry 
 (name,email,phone,treatment,gender,date) values       ('$name','$email','$phone','$treatment','$gender','$date')";

if(mysqli_query($db_conx, $query)){

echo "<script>alert('Thank you for submitting your query, our doctors will       call you soon!')</script>";
  }

  mail ( $to,  $subject,  
  "From:"  . $name .  
 ",   Email: " . $email . 
 ",   Number: ". $phone .   
 ",   Gender: " . $gender.
 ",   Treatment: " . $treatment.
 ",   Message: " . $message    );



 }


 ?>
尝试使用
标题('位置:http://xxxxxxxx)
参考:

尝试使用
标题('位置:http://xxxxxxxx)
参考:


这里有两个选项

1) 您可以使用:

header('Location: http://domain.com/thank-you.html');
2) 使用javascript:

window.location.href='http://domain.com/thankyou.html';
而且,
您可以通过Ajax发布邮件数据,如果数据发布成功,您可以重定向:)

您在这里有两个选项

1) 您可以使用:

header('Location: http://domain.com/thank-you.html');
2) 使用javascript:

window.location.href='http://domain.com/thankyou.html';
而且,
您可以通过Ajax发布邮件数据,如果数据发布成功,您可以重定向:)

您的代码不安全。它容易受到和的攻击。您的代码不安全。它容易受到和的攻击。您好,先生,您能告诉我我必须在我的代码中写入标题选项的位置吗?您可以在
echo“alert('谢谢您提交您的查询,我们的医生很快会给您打电话!”)之后使用但既然您已经在使用javascript,javascript对您来说是更好的方法:)您好,先生,您能告诉我我必须在代码中写入标题选项的位置吗?您可以在
echo“alert('谢谢您提交查询,我们的医生很快会打电话给您!”)之后使用
但由于您已经在使用javascript,所以javascript对您来说是更好的方法:)